As a Business Analyst in Amazon Ads, you will be working in one of the most most complex data ecosystem.
An ideal candidate should have deep expertise in design, creation, management, and business use of extremely large datasets.
Strong fundamentals in SQL , python and optimization techniques.
You should have excellent communication skills to be able to work independently with our Tech, BI and Business partners to develop and answer the key business questions.
You should be expert at designing, implementing, and operating stable, scalable, low cost solutions to flow data from production systems into the data warehouse and into end-user facing applications. You should be able to work with business customers in understanding the business requirements and implementing data as a service solutions.
You should be able to think beyond the current environment and automate the workflows wherever needed.
Preferred:
Knows and keen to implement AI solutions.
